Our guest today will prove that you can either make excuses or make adjustments. You think it’s hard to find stage time where you live? Try getting up in northern Utah. You can’t find a place to do a show? Start your own comedy night. You bomb horribly at your first attempt? Walk it off and try again.

Karen Eddington joins us on the show today to discuss how she overcame performing comedy in the rough bars of Utah. That’s right. Utah.

I first met Karen when she called and asked about the online writing course. She already had some stage time but wanted to punch up her jokes. She definitely has done that. Today, we cross paths in Washington D. C. at the National Speaker’s Association Influence 2015 conference. At the conference Karen is presenting a session on comedy writing. She has great tips for us all.

She’ll tell us how to

  • Create your own comedy night
  • Where to get a venue for free
  • Her “comedy changing” revolution
  • How to create bigger surprises
  • Using CONTRAST to bring focus to the punchline
  • Increasing your laughs per minute
  • 3 reasons an audience might not laugh
  • How she works hard to vary the topics in her material
  • The importance of networking
  • And making the transition from speaking to becoming a “mom comedian"
